ali Posted December 23, 2015 Share Posted December 23, 2015 (edited) if you're thinking of agency work then Nurse West is also one to consider. ETA - the problem with agency is that you don't of course get holiday or sick pay and you may be offered shifts far and wide. It is something to consider if you aren't able to get a substantive post right away, but for me personally, I would want the security of regular work, being part of a team etc., when newly arriving - it can help you settle.
